    ABOUT US

    At CureSearch for Children’s Cancer, we don’t wait—we act. For over 35 years, we’ve been driving bold, innovative childhood cancer research that gets promising new treatments to kids faster. Every day, 42 families hear the devastating words, “Your child has cancer.” Our mission is to ensure that every child diagnosed with cancer has a safe and effective treatment option. We’re a small but mighty team, working remotely yet closely connected, and we’re looking for a powerhouse Community Engagement Manager to help us fuel our life-saving work.

    ABOUT THE ROLE

    This is not your average fundraising role. We need a go-getter—someone who thrives on building relationships, mobilizing communities, and creating new opportunities where none exist. You won’t be sitting around waiting for volunteers and donors to come to us—you’ll be out there making it happen. You’ll identify and recruit top-tier volunteers, rally communities to support our cause, and drive revenue through peer-to-peer fundraising. If you’re resourceful, fearless, and ready to make an impact, we want you on our team.

    This full-time, exempt position reports to the Director of Community Engagement and plays a critical role in our Development team. You’ll work remotely from a home-based office in the Mid-Atlantic Region, ideally in Metro Washington, D.C./Baltimore, Metro Philadelphia, or Richmond, VA. Easy access to a major airport is required.

    WHAT YOU’LL DO

    Revenue Generation:

    • Own and execute a strategic community fundraising plan to hit an annual revenue goal of $350,000-$400,000 - with growth plans to increase portfolio fundraising beyond $500,000 in the next two fiscal years.
    • Proactively recruit, train, and mobilize high-impact volunteers to grow our Ultimate Hike and CureSearch Walk programs in the Mid-Atlantic region.
    • Develop and launch creative, local fundraising campaigns that resonate with communities.
    • Build relationships with local corporations to secure sponsorships and in-kind support.
    • Drive cost efficiency to maximize revenue impact.

    Community Engagement & Leadership Development:

    • Identify and empower high-value volunteer leaders to drive fundraising and awareness on Community Leadership Boards in Washington, DC/Baltimore, Philadelphia, Central Virginia, and other markets.
    • Cultivate and engage the local leadership board, UH Ambassadors, Walk committee members, and more to champion our cause.
    • Build strong community partnerships and expand our network of supporters.
    • Represent CureSearch at community events, sharing our mission and impact.

    Peer-to-Peer Fundraising:

    • Recruit and coach individual and team fundraisers at Ultimate Hike and Walk events, helping them exceed their goals.
    • Analyze participation trends and adjust strategies to ensure fundraising success.
    • Partner with internal event teams to deliver unforgettable participant experiences.
    • Provide onsite support at key fundraising events.

    Marketing & Communications:

    • Collaborate with our marketing team to craft compelling, localized messaging.
    • Empower local marketing chairs on community leadership boards to draft and execute robust grassroots marketing campaigns that include flyer canvassing, earning media opportunities, and other local means of marketing our events.
    • Leverage community media and digital channels to boost fundraising efforts.

    WHAT WE’RE LOOKING FOR

    • Bachelor's degree preferred, or 5+ years of relevant experience in fundraising, nonprofit management, or volunteer engagement.
    • 3+ years of successful community fundraising, peer-to-peer fundraising, or volunteer leadership experience.
    • A self-starter mentality—you’re proactive, resourceful, and thrive in an entrepreneurial environment.
    • Strong leadership and relationship-building skills; you know how to motivate and mobilize volunteers.
    • Excellent communication skills—you’re persuasive, inspiring, and can rally a crowd.
    • Strategic thinker with a data-driven approach to fundraising growth.
    • Proficiency in fundraising software and CRM tools.
    • Willingness to work some evenings and weekends; travel 15-20% of the time.
    • Passion for our mission and an ability to engage communities on a deep, personal level.
    • A valid driver’s license and ability to lift 25-30 lbs. for event setup.

    Benefits

    CureSearch offers fair and competitive compensation and a comprehensive benefits package that includes generous paid time off (vacation, sick, and float holiday time), summer Fridays, the week off between Christmas and New Year’s, wellness benefits, medical, dental, vision, life, short/long-term disability, and 401(k) retirement plan with an employer match after one year of employment. As a remote team, we also offer equipment and phone stipends
